Tianwan 7 gets lower tier of inner containment dome

The 44-metre diameter lower tier of the inner containment dome, weighing 391 tonnes, has been lifted into position on the seventh unit of the Tianwan nuclear power plant in China.  A crane with a 2000-tonne capacity was moved to the construction site to complete the lift. Xudabao 3 vessel passes hydrostatic tests

The reactor pressure vessel (RPV) for unit 3 at the Xudabao nuclear power plant in China’s Liaoning province has successfully completed hydrostatic testing in Russia. Westinghouse announces a new small nuclear reactor — a notable step in the industry’s efforts to remake itself

Westinghouse announced the launch of a small version of its flagship AP1000 nuclear reactor on Thursday. The new reactor, called the AP300, aims to be available in 2027, and will generate about a third of the power as the flagship AP1000 reactor, enough to power about 300,000 homes. Construction begins of third unit at Egypt’s El Dabaa nuclear power plant

First concrete has been poured into the foundation slab marking the start of the main construction phase for unit 3 of the El Dabaa nuclear power plant project, and follows the issuing of a construction licence by the Egyptian Nuclear and Radiological Regulatory Authority on 29 March. Hot Functional Testing completed for Vogtle Unit 4

Georgia Power today announced the completion of hot functional testing for Unit 4 at the Vogtle nuclear expansion project near Waynesboro, Ga. The completion of hot functional testing marks a significant step towards operations and providing customers with a reliable, carbon-free energy source for the next 60 to 80 years.
